Wattie Landon "Smitty" Smith, 77, of North Charleston, South Carolina, husband of Christine Winn Smith entered into eternal rest Friday, July 4, 2014. His Funeral Service will be held Monday, July 7, 2014 at 10:00 am in J. HENRY STUHR INC., WEST ASHLEY CHAPEL, 3360 Glenn McConnell Parkway. Interment will follow in Beaver Dam Baptist Cemetery, 4611 Ridegland Road, Ridgeland, SC at 1:30 pm. The family will receive friends in Stuhr's West Ashley Chapel Sunday from 5:00 pm to 7:00 pm.

Wattie was born October 9, 1936 in Jasper County, South Carolina, son of the late Claude Smith and Patience Mixson Smith. Wattie was married to Christine for 57 years. He loved his wife, girls and grandchildren dearly. Smitty was a busy man, he had many talents and skills, he did not like to sit still. He was working, repairing and tinkering with something, there was never anything he could not fix. He enjoyed fishing, crabbing and getting oysters. In addition to his welding skills, he could cook, sew, lay brick, electrical and carpentry work. He was a great mechanic having been involved in area racetracks. Everyone came to Wattie for help or advice on cars, lawnmowers, trailers and other things. Wattie's passion was planting several gardens at one time, he planted every vegetable known year round and shared with family, neighbors and friends. Wattie was well known for his delicious huge collard greens.

He is survived by his wife of 57 years, Christine Winn Smith of North Charleston, SC; two daughters, Karen Smith Bedenbaugh (Steve) of Goose Creek, SC, Susan Smith Black (John) of Hanahan, SC; three sisters, Alberta Zeigler of Hampstead, NC, Lillian Lollis of Warm Springs, GA, Geri Hendrix of Savannah, GA; four grandchildren, Craig Records, Melissa Bedenbaugh, Brittany Black, Bradley Bedenbaugh and many nieces and nephews. Wattie is preceded in death by his sister, Dot Moore and brother Claude Smith Jr.
